8

これは、Windows で 15 年以上のコーディング経験があり、Mac OS X でゼロから始めている人からの初心者向けの質問です。Web とこのサイトを検索しましたが、答えは見つかりませんでしたが、答えは多くの人に役立つと思います人の。

非常に簡単に....

  1. プライベート コードとプロジェクトは、ファイル システムのどこに保存すればよいですか? 私のユーザーディレクトリ?/usr/?

  2. 共有コードとプロジェクトはどこに保存すればよいですか?

  3. github リポジトリはどこに設定すればよいですか?

  4. ビルドしたら、どこにアプリケーションをインストールすればよいですか? ここには多くの可能性があります。/opt/、/var/lib、/usr/local/var など。

  5. おそらく最も興味深いのは、自分の Mac にインストールされているすべてのものの場所を簡単に調べるにはどうすればよいかということです。

UNIX の 40 年の歴史の中で、これらの標準がいくつか出てきたと思いますが、これまでのところ、それらを見つけることができませんでした。私が従うべき「ベストプラクティス」のガイドラインがいくつかあるはずです。

ところで、私は PostgreSQL などについて話しているのです。適切な Mac アプリケーションではありません。

私が尋ねる理由は、同じアプリケーションをどこにインストールするかについて独自のアイデアを持っているように見えるものをインストールするさまざまな方法に出くわしたからです。例: homebrew、ant など。これらは、アプリケーションの手動インストールに関する FAQ やドキュメントに従う場合とは異なるインストール場所になることがあります。

これらに関する回答をお待ちしております。

どうもありがとう。

4

1 に答える 1

4

Github には、Github リポジトリをダウンロードして同期できる非常に優れた Mac アプリケーションがあります。デフォルトでは、~/Documents (ホーム フォルダーのドキュメント ディレクトリ) 内のサブディレクトリに配置されます。

私のホームセットアップは、〜内にgitディレクトリを作成し、それをプライベートプロジェクトに使用することです. 共有プロジェクトの場合は、それらを /Users/Shared に配置します (Mac OS には全員に共通の共有フォルダーがあります)。

コマンド ライン ツールのインストールに関しては、Mac は BSD ボックスのようなものです。/usr/local/bin などにインストールします。グラフィカル アプリケーションは /Applications に配置する必要があります。Github の Mac アプリは、コマンド ライン ツール (オプション) を /usr/local/bin にインストールします。

OS X の一部のパッケージ ツールは独自のディレクトリ階層 (fink、macports) を作成しますが、mirports は /usr/local にインストールされます。

于 2012-08-17T16:55:31.030 に答える